JUST IN: Gov Fubara to Address State on Expiration of Local Government Chairmen’s Tenures
Rivers State Governor, Sir Siminalayi Fubara, GSSRS, is scheduled to make a statewide broadcast regarding the expiration of the tenure of local government council chairmen and councillors. This address will take place on Tuesday, June 18, 2024, at 7 AM.
Residents are encouraged to tune in to all radio and television stations to listen to the Governor’s message. The announcement comes amid rising tension and uncertainty as the tenures of the local government officials come to an end.
Nelson Chukwudi, the Chief Press Secretary to the Governor, issued this notice on Monday, June 17, 2024.
This announcement is critical as it follows recent court rulings and political disputes over the legality of extending the officials’ terms.
